Project Coordinator – Limassol
The Project Coordinator supports the planning and coordination of construction projects, ensuring effective communication between teams and helping maintain project timelines. The role involves tracking progress, managing documentation, and supporting day-to-day project activities.
Requirements:
* Fluency in Greek and English (spoken and written).
* Valid driving license.
* Degree in Civil Engineering, Construction, or a related field will be considered an advantage.
* Strong organizational and communication skills.
